Across TCGA cell cohorts, PLEC mutation is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 2,262 significant associations in total. LARGE_INTESTINE sh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ible PLEC-associated genes across cancer lineages are FUT10, CRACD, and ASTN2. Each is linked with PLEC in more than 4 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both PLEC-to-partner and partner-to-PLEC results are reported.
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The box plot shows the strongest example, FUT10 grouped by PLEC-low versus PLEC-high in LARGE_INTESTINE.
